John Ourand / SportsBusiness Journal:
Red Sox lose RSN ratings lead  —  Local numbers show Cardinals, Twins, Phillies, Reds in front  —  The Boston Red Sox's six-year reign atop MLB's local television ratings is about to end, as the team's local numbers have plummeted from first to fifth this season.

Peter Abraham / Boston Globe:
TV and radio ratings fall for Red Sox  —  Interesting story in the Sports Business Journal today about the decline in local television ratings for the Red Sox.  —  After six years atop baseball's local TV ratings list, the Sox are fifth this year as ratings have dropped 36 percent.
